In the Japan multi-mode fiber optic rotary joints market, applications are segmented across various industries to cater to specific operational needs. The industrial sector dominates this market segment, leveraging fiber optic rotary joints for high-speed data transmission and signal integrity in manufacturing processes and automation systems. This application ensures seamless communication between rotating parts, essential for industrial machinery where reliability and minimal signal loss are critical.

The defense sector in Japan also adopts multi-mode fiber optic rotary joints extensively, particularly in military equipment and surveillance systems. These joints facilitate uninterrupted data transfer across moving parts in radar systems, optical communications, and navigation equipment. Similarly, the medical industry utilizes fiber optic rotary joints for advanced imaging and diagnostic equipment, enabling precise data transmission without interference. In aerospace applications, these joints play a crucial role in communication systems within aircraft and satellites, ensuring reliable connectivity amidst mechanical rotations. Lastly, in research and development environments, fiber optic rotary joints are integral to experimental setups and scientific instrumentation, supporting data-intensive experiments and analysis where rotational movement is involved.

1. What is a multi mode fiber optic rotary joint?

A multi mode fiber optic rotary joint is a device that allows for the transmission of optical signals across rotating interfaces, typically used in applications such as military, aerospace, and medical imaging systems.

5. What are the different types of multi mode fiber optic rotary joints available in the market?

The multi mode fiber optic rotary joints market offers various types of products such as electrical slip rings with fiber optic rotary joints, capsule slip rings with fiber optic rotary joints, and separate fiber optic rotary joints.

6. What are the application areas for multi mode fiber optic rotary joints?

Multi mode fiber optic rotary joints are used in applications such as radars, electro-optical systems, undersea cable systems, and medical imaging devices.
